Ben Donaldson started his career as a Cisco and Microsoft IT engineer before moving into sales and account management.
ombining a technical background with his move into business development Ben has gone on to start 3 IT Infrastructure and Managed Services businesses. These businesses have achieved significant success and rapid growth with one venture making the BRW Fast Starters list on multiple occasions and rapidly expanding across Australia and Internationally.
After a short break to explore other business ventures, Ben returned to the IT industry in 2014 joining PSQ Group IT as a Partner, Director and Investor. Outside of the IT industry, Ben is a Partner and Managing Director of an International Services business based in KL, Malaysia and interests in a property development group, PSQ Group Investments of which he is the Managing Director. PSQ Group Investments focuses on residential development projects and land acquisition.

Gary is a qualified Chartered Accountant and holds a Bachelor of Business degree completed at Edith Cowan University, majoring in Accounting and Finance.
Gary began his working life in the public sector rising to deputy manager of a large Government office before transitioning to the Accounting industry. After deciding on a career change, Gary commenced university studies during which he received numerous awards for outstanding achievements including an international
scholarship. Upon graduation, Gary was awarded the Business School’s prestigious Faculty Medal for the top graduating student. After a period with one of the ‘Big 4’ accounting firms, Gary found his niche in servicing smaller businesses and assisting them achieve their financial & business goals. Gary has been a Chartered Accountant for over 13 years, and is the Principal in his own boutique accounting firm located in Perth’s northern suburbs.
